About Little caesars pizza bites

Little Caesars Pizza Bites are a bite-sized twist on classic pizza, inspired by Italian-American cuisine. Each piece features a soft, fluffy dough stuffed with a flavorful blend of mozzarella cheese and zesty pizza sauce, delivering the signature taste of traditional pizza in a convenient, shareable form. Topped with a hint of garlic and parmesan seasoning, these bites are baked to a golden perfection for a satisfyingly savory snack. While indulgent and rich in flavor, Pizza Bites are relatively high in sodium, saturated fat, and calories, which may not make them ideal for daily consumption. However, they offer protein from the cheese and are a fun occasional treat for pizza lovers looking for portable comfort food. Pair them with a fresh salad or veggie sticks for a more balanced meal option.
